Doon definition of Doon in the Free Online Encyclopedia.
Doon (d n), river, c.30 mi (48 km) long, South Ayrshire and East Ayrshire, SW Scotland, flowing NW through Loch Doon (6 mi/9.7 km long) to the Firth of Clyde S of Ayr.
